It Caught My Eye — True Meaning Of Christmas?

This tree lives at the Gehry designed Edgemar Center in Santa Monica on Main Street. It is made of 83 shopping carts and seems to reflect how some of us feel about the shopping frenzy that has become the holidays. (click for bigger holiday art statement.)

Speaking of holiday shopping, click past the jump for that perfect retro gift.


Spotted at a bike shop on Main St. in Santa Monica. Click for bigger shiny memories.

These beauties brought back a ton of memories. Those high handle bars with sparkly tassels, that banana seat — two could ride! Three if someone sat between those handle bars. Good times.

One thought on “It Caught My Eye — True Meaning Of Christmas?”

Comments are closed.